  • What is the best course of action during a dental emergency?

    Whenever you experience something wrong with your mouth or teeth and feel it’s a dental emergency, it is easy to start to worry about the best steps you should take next. Whenever you enter a dental emergency, there are a multiple steps that you can take to help fix the problem, which include don't panic and act quickly.

    • Be calm: It is easy to panic when dental emergencies happen. Do your best to be calm and analyze the problem. Whether you are faced with a crack in a tooth or some discomfort and swelling in the mouth, you need to work through the problem and stay calm.
    • Act efficiently: Whenever you have some urgent dental issue, you must act in the most efficient way. Request a member of your family call the Hialeah, FL urgent dental clinic or help to take you into the office. You may want to bring an ice pack or some pain relievers to help cope with the swelling and ache. Some clean gauze on the area that’s bleeding is going to help stop it.
    • Find and preserve the oral structures: In case a tooth broke or chipped, we suggest you find all of the pieces that you can. After they are gathered, you can put them into a sealed container or plastic bag. You can show this to Hialeah dental professional when you come to the office.
    • Go to the dentist clinic: If you can, give us a call when you are ready so that we can get ready and have you admitted immediately.
    • How can you prevent a dental emergency?

      You can take several different steps you can take to help prevent dental emergencies and keep your mouth as healthy as is possible. A few of the steps you can take to fend off these dental emergencies are: Watch what you eat: Eat healthy and wholesome food to help stop cavities. Numerous dental emergencies stem from a small dental problem, like a small cavity, which can become a terrible toothache that needs a considerable amount of treatment. Try to decrease intake of any liquids and food that are very sweet and eat as healthy as possible. 2) Use added protection: Whether you engage in a sport that can lead to jaw injury or you simply grind your teeth during nighttime, you should use a mouthguard to keep yourself safe. 3) Practice great oral hygiene: Make sure you are brushing your teeth twice per day, floss at least one time a day, and utilize mouthwash to keep your mouth healthy and stop oral health issues.
